Scenic drive of the Rocky Mountains

brickenridge, colorado

Top of the Rockies Scenic Byway If you take I-70 further west toward Copper Mountain and turn south onto highway 91, you’ll officially be on the Top of the Rockies Scenic Byway. You’ll pass several 14ers, including Quandary Peak (14,265 ft), Mount Lincoln (14,286 ft), and Mount Democrat (14,148 ft), and after about 30 minutes, you’ll end up in the highest incorporated town in the country: Leadville, Colorado. Take highway 24 out of Leadville heading north and you’ll climb the Tennessee Pass, which tops out at 10,424 feet, cruise over the breathtaking Steel Arched Bridge outside the hidden town of Red Cliff, past the ghost town of Gilman, and finally end up in Vail. Take I-70 back east to hit Frisco and Breckenridge. All told the loop will take you somewhere around 2.5-3 hours, and in that time, you’ll pass through some of Colorado’s most beautiful and historic scenery.
